Journal of the Ramanujan Mathematical Society, Vol 14, No 1 (1999), Pagination: 65-93
Abstract
In this survey article, we review several known results about syzygies for projective surfaces and present some new ones. We also give an outline of some of the ideas and techniques to handle these types of problems.
